Peter Darman is a British author with a background in history.
He attended King's Grammar School in Grantham, where he first wrote about military history.
Darman pursued higher education at Nottingham University, earning a BA in history and international relations.
He later completed a Master of Philosophy at the University of York, focusing on Prince Rupert of the Rhine's generalship during the English Civil War.
His research took him to Oxford and the British Library.
Darman's writing career began when he joined a small publishing company as an editor in London.
